COVID-19: 10 new positive cases and 10 recoveries on Friday 1rst January

Ten new positive cases of COVID-19 were identified on Friday.

This therefore brings the overall health figures for the Principality to 885 people affected by the Coronavirus since the beginning of the health crisis.

This evening, twenty people are being treated at the CHPG:  nineteen patients, eight of whom are residents, are hospitalised. In addition, one patient, resident, is in intensive care.

Today, there are 10 further recoveries to be noted.  The total number of people who have recovered thus amounts to 718. 

This Friday evening, 100 people are being monitored by the Home Patient Follow-up Centre, which provides medical support to people with mild symptoms, who are invited to self-isolate at home.

In line with the practices adopted by the World Health Organization and neighbouring countries in this regard, these daily health assessment figures report only on resident persons affected by the Coronavirus.
